# Shaker function factory ----
# Factory that takes either a replacement or a dict vector and produces a
# function that randomly samples a percentage of it (the default), or samples a
# specified number of values from it.
fill_shakers <- function(v) {
assertthat::assert_that(is.character(v))
assertthat::assert_that(length(v) > 0)
f <- function(n = NULL, i = NULL, p = 0.5) {
# If a length is supplied, sample vector l times with replacement
if (!is.null(n)) {
assertthat::assert_that(assertthat::is.count(n))
return(sample(v, size = n, replace = TRUE))
}
# If exact indices are supplied, return i positions of the vector
if (!is.null(i)) {
assertthat::assert_that(is.integer(i))
assertthat::assert_that(all(i) %in% seq_along(v))
return(v[i])
}
# If a proportion is supplied, sample that proportion of the vector
assertthat::assert_that(is.proportion(p))
vi <- p_indices(v, p)
return(v[vi])
}
structure(f, source = v)
}
